Output 3dfe7140bbf9fa431e660fb6f377c03efd97110eb0a076332be8b6271491dd6a:2

value
30388066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f0480eeba3efb5d9cd5e8f890e9427b398848e OP_EQUAL
address
MWxaMpanowM2Bgr7rQy2WcjkGZBNp4Sgrj
transaction
3dfe7140bbf9fa431e660fb6f377c03efd97110eb0a076332be8b6271491dd6a
spent
true